The impact of the Southern Ocean on climate The Southern Ocean Carbon and Climate Observations and Modeling Program (SOCCOM) MBARI Scientist Ken Johnson and his Chemical Sensors Group are part of a large collaborative effort to place sensors in the Southern Ocean to monitor changing conditions.
